1. The Illusion of Prosperity in PoS: A Carefully Designed Financial Harvest
After Ethereum shifted to the proof-of-stake (PoS) mechanism, it seemingly solved the energy consumption controversy of proof-of-work (PoW) under the banner of "energy saving," but in fact opened a Pandora’s box far more complex than energy use. The core products of this transformation are the liquid staking token (LST) and the liquidity re-mortgage token (LRT), which have spawned a sophisticated financial arbitrage system, turning decentralized finance (DeFi) into a carnival for institutional harvesting.
Taking lending protocols like Aave and Compound as examples, institutional arbitrage paths have become standardized: first, pledge ETH to liquidity staking providers like Lido to obtain stETH (LST); then deposit stETH into lending protocols as collateral to borrow ETH; then repeat the "pledge - borrow" cycle, amplifying staking yields through loop operations. The essence of this "loop lending" is to exploit the difference between ETH staking returns (currently about 2.5%) and borrowing rates (usually below 2%). On the surface, institutions are "contributing to network security," but in reality, no real value is created—staking rewards are ultimately sold back into the market, forming persistent structural selling pressure.
Even more ironic, this arbitrage scale has far exceeded ecological capacity. Data from 2025 shows over 60% of staked ETH on Ethereum is concentrated via platforms like Lido, with institutional-held LST accounting for 78% of total circulating supply. When thousands of addresses engage in "-loop staking," the actual circulating ETH is artificially suppressed but secretly accumulated: the ultimate goal of institutional arbitrage is to cash out staking rewards, not hold long-term. This "left hand to right hand" game turns Ethereum’s security budget (staking yield essentially into a transfer payment for network security ), morphing into inflation tax—holders not only bear price volatility risks but also pay for institutional arbitrage.
Under PoS, ETH has been thoroughly transformed into "perpetual bonds." The current 2.5% staking yield is below the US 10-year Treasury (around 4.5%), and far less attractive than high-yield emerging market currencies’ bonds. This "negative spread" exposes its fundamental flaw as a store of value: when institutional investors can get higher risk-free returns in traditional financial markets, ETH’s staking yield loses competitiveness. Vitalik Buterin once claimed PoS could make ETH "a better currency," but in reality, Wall Street’s arbitrage algorithms have squeezed ETH’s financial attributes to the limit, and the original vision of "decentralized finance" on blockchain is degenerating into a joke under capital’s alienation.
2. The Civilizational Value of PoW: The Ultimate Logic of Energy as Money
In stark contrast to the financialization trap of PoS, PoW’s adherence to the underlying physical world logic is evident. Elon Musk defines Bitcoin as "a fundamentally energy-based physical currency," not just a marketing slogan, but a revelation of the essential law of value storage: converting each unit of electricity into hash computation is transforming unforgeable physical entropy into digital scarcity. Under this mechanism, energy consumption is not "waste," but a natural barrier against inflation; the absolute security built by computational power competition is the ultimate safe haven when fiat systems collapse.
The core charm of PoW lies in "physical anchoring." Bitcoin’s issuance is directly tied to energy consumption: mining equipment converts electrical energy into computational power, competing via SHA-256 hashing to earn block rewards. This process is like directly forging "digital gold" from energy, with each Bitcoin corresponding to a specific energy cost. When global fiat currencies depreciate due to central bank over-issuance, Bitcoin’s energy consumption anchoring makes it a natural "anti-inflation asset." From 2020 to 2024, global M2 growth exceeded 20%, while Bitcoin’s price surged 500%, demonstrating how energy value crushes fiat credit.
From the perspective of civilization evolution, PoW’s energy-based currency embodies the Kardashev civilization index. Humanity is transitioning from planetary to stellar civilization; improvements in energy utilization efficiency will determine the form of value storage. In the industrial age, gold served as a value measure due to its physical scarcity; in the information age, Bitcoin converts energy into digital scarcity via PoW, immune to single-government control and globally circulating—highlighting the fatal flaw of fiat systems amid global conflicts.
